Five Bishops garner USA South Athlete of the Week accolades

Fayetteville, NC - The North Carolina Wesleyan Department of Athletics is pleased to announce that five Battling Bishop athletes have earned USA South Athlete of the Week accolades in their respective sports. Teron Bush and James Wallace of football were tabbed Offensive Player and Defensive Rookie of Week, while Kelly George of volleyball was named Defensive Player of the Week. In men's tennis, Wesleyan swept two awards as Alexey Rumyantsev and Erkut Cakmak garnered Player and Rookie of the Week honors. more >

Bishops wrap up fall season with five championship wins at MU

Fayetteville, NC - The Battling Bishop men's tennis team wrapped up their fall season in style this past weekend, earning championship wins all in five flights they competed in at the Methodist Fall invitational. Sophomore Alexey Rumyantsev (pictured) led the way with a 4-0 singles mark in the "A" draw to secure Wesleyan's first title. Other champions in their respective flights were Marcelo Prata
(B singles), Erkut Cakmak (C singles), Anton Filinov & Clayton Sonn
(A doubles), and Ilpo Kautonen & Evgeniy Bukatin (B doubles). more >

Tingle and Saari earn USA South Player of the Week honors

Fayetteville, NC - The North Carolina Wesleyan Department of Athletics is pleased to announce that sophomore Mackenzie Tingle of volleyball and junior Antti Saari of men's tennis have earned USA South Player of the Week honors in their respective sports. Tingle led her Bishops to a 2-1 record this past week, while Saari went 4-1 in singles play at the ITA Regional Tournament. This is the first award of the season for both. more >

Saari paces Bishop men's tennis at ITA Regional Tournament

Sewanee, TN - With a 4-1 singles record and semifinal appearance, junior Antti Saari paced his North Carolina Wesleyan men's tennis team at this past weekend's ITA Regional Tourney in Sewanee, TN. Saari (pictured), the tourney's #2 seed, defeated three players from Emory University before falling to eventual champion Dillon Pottish. As a team, the Battling Bishops collected 15 singles victories. more >

Bishop men's tennis tabbed 16th in final ITA national rankings

Rocky Mount, NC - The Intercollegiate Tennis Association (ITA) has released its final national rankings for the 2009 season with the Battling Bishops of NC Wesleyan coming in at #16. The ranking is the highest in the history of the men's tennis program and caps a record-breaking season that saw Wesleyan capture the USA South Regular Season and Tournament Championships, as well as an NCAA berth. more >
